Welcome to Madison, Wisconsin:

Economic Data

Strong/Stable Economy anchored by the University of Wisconsin and Federal, State, County and Local Government

  • Diversified and dynamic private sector marked by an fast growing trade and service industry
  • Low unemployment rate
  • Nearly 500 Greater Madison high-tech businesses with 28,000 employees and $5.5 billion in sales and/or government contracts.

City Facts

  • Regional Airport - 100 flight arrivals and departures daily
  • 12 Convention Hotels with nearly 3,000 sleeping rooms
  • 5,000 acres of parks
  • 5 connected lakes with 2,080 acres
  • 13 beaches
  • 11 boat launches
  • 4 public golf courses
  • 6 private golf courses

UW Madison Data

  • The University of Wisconsin has the highest research budget of any university in the nation regarding non-classified research
  • The University of Wisconsin has the 3rd largest research expenditure of all universities in the nation
  • The University of Wisconsin currently holds the three top patents for human embriotic stem cells.
